According to the game code, this is not a bug :
Code:
0E5D1: 8A 1E 28 05 mov bl,byte ptr [528h]
0E5D5: 3A 1E 34 05 cmp bl,byte ptr [534h]
0E5D9: 75 09 jne 0E5E4h
0E5DB: 80 FB 02 cmp bl,2h
0E5DE: 76 0E jbe 0E5EEh
0E5E0: B3 02 mov bl,2h
0E5E2: EB 02 jmp 0E5E6h
0E5E4: 32 DB xor bl,bl
0E5E6: 88 1E 28 05 mov byte ptr [528h],bl
0E5EA: 88 1E 34 05 mov byte ptr [534h],bl
0E5EE: A0 29 05 mov al,[529h]
This means that if you have 2 credits or less in NVRAM, nothing is changed when you launch or reset the game; and if you have more than 2 credits, this number of credits will be changed to 2 ...
Now the question is why there are more than 2 credits the first time you launch the game ... This is because the NVRAM handler defaults all values to 0xff when the .nv file doesn't exist :
Code:
static MACHINE_DRIVER_START( gottlieb )
...
MDRV_NVRAM_HANDLER(generic_1fill)
...
MACHINE_DRIVER_END

Note that the behaviour is the same with the clone 'mplanuk' (even if the addresses are slightly different) :
Code:
0E5D1: 8A 1E 28 05 mov bl,byte ptr [528h]
0E5D5: 3A 1E 3E 05 cmp bl,byte ptr [53Eh]
0E5D9: 75 09 jne 0E5E4h
0E5DB: 80 FB 02 cmp bl,2h
0E5DE: 76 0E jbe 0E5EEh
0E5E0: B3 02 mov bl,2h
0E5E2: EB 02 jmp 0E5E6h
0E5E4: 32 DB xor bl,bl
0E5E6: 88 1E 28 05 mov byte ptr [528h],bl
0E5EA: 88 1E 3E 05 mov byte ptr [53Eh],bl
0E5EE: A0 29 05 mov al,[529h]
